Wyskakujący pasek narzędzi Androida Motyw vs motyw

93

Często widzę tę deklarację paska narzędzi w plikach układu:

<android.support.v7.widget.Toolbar
    xmlns:android="http://schemas.android.com/apk/res/android"
    android:layout_width="match_parent"
    android:layout_height="?attr/actionBarSize"
    app:theme="@style/ThemeOverlay.AppCompat.Dark.ActionBar"
    app:popupTheme="@style/ThemeOverlay.AppCompat.Light">
</android.support.v7.widget.Toolbar>

Dlaczego istnieją dwa atrybuty związane z motywem: motyw i wyskakujący motyw?

Jakie są cele każdego z nich?

Witalij Zinczenko
źródło

Odpowiedzi:

133
  1. popupTheme

    Określa motyw, który ma być używany podczas wypełniania menu podręcznych. Domyślnie używa tego samego motywu co on Toolbarsam.

  2. motyw

    To jest po prostu temat Toolbar.

Nouman Ghaffar
źródło
7
Właśnie powiedziałeś, czego potrzebowałem
Farid
1
Dziękujemy za „Domyślnie używa tego samego motywu co pasek narzędzi Toolbar” . Czy mógłbyś podać jakieś źródła zacytowania tego?
Weekend
1
tak, Google musi zatrudniać więcej pisarzy technicznych. Wiele najnowszych dokumentów jest bardzo „rozwodnionych”. (Właśnie dlatego nienawidzę pracy z Firebase)
Someone Somewhere
3
Co to jest menu podręczne? :)
M.kazem Akhgary
8
@ M.kazemAkhgary to menu, które pojawia się po dotknięciu ikony przepełnienia (trzech kropek) na dowolnym pasku narzędzi.
Jacob Ras